Is the rearview mirror folding automatic on the Toyota RAV4? It depends on the model year and technical configuration. I've driven many models, and the high-end versions of the RAV4 usually come with a motorized folding system. Pressing the button on the driver's side panel automatically folds the mirrors, and they can also retract automatically when locking the car. Compared to manual versions, automatic folding is more efficient, especially in narrow garages or roadside parking—just one click without needing to step out of the car. Base models, like the entry-level version, may require manual adjustment, which is a bit more cumbersome. Related features also include the mirror adjustment switch and position memory function, where the automatic version can remember the user's preferred angle. Overall, checking the vehicle's technical specifications when choosing will save you time and effort.

How to Format a Car Dash Cam?

Click the button on the far right of the dash cam to enter the settings interface. Locate the memory card formatting option in the interface and select it again using the touch button on the far right to perform the formatting operation on the memory card. Different models of car dash cams vary, so the operation methods for memory cards also differ. Currently, most dash cams default to a loop recording mode. In this mode, the videos recorded by the dash cam will be segmented into clips of certain durations (such as 1 minute, 3 minutes, 5 minutes, or 10 minutes) and stored in the memory card. When the memory card space is full, new videos will overwrite the oldest ones. This not only prevents the inability to continue recording due to a full memory card but also saves car owners the hassle of frequently formatting the memory card.
